Spinnin’ Records taps into classic cumbia vibes on sexy new single ‘La Colegiala’

Spinnin’ Records have tapped into the Latin influences currently dominating the dance circuit with their latest release, “La Colegiala,” from The Boy Next Door and Fresh Coast. The invigorating track features Dutch-Colombian vocalist Jody Bernal who has made a name for himself with his cultural mash ups.

Together, the producers have turned a 1980 cumbia track of the same name  into a hot, dirty summer dance floor heater full of moombahton and latin dancehall vibes.

“I know this track from my childhood. It brings back some amazing memories. The Boy Next Door and Fresh Coast sent me this track and told me that they were looking for a Spanish vocalist. When I saw the name of the song ‘La Colegiala’, I immediately got goosebumps all over,” said Jody Bernal in a press release.  “When I heard the first eight seconds, I was blown away! So, hopefully we will give you some amazing memories with our new version of ‘La Colegiala’!”

“La Colegiala” is out now via Spinnin’ Records.
